A new piece of technology is a solar inverter that can also charge electric vehicles (EVs) directly through a portable solar panel system. The integration of a solar inverter with an EV charger is an ingenious solution that prevents the installation of a dedicated electric vehicle charger, as well as any necessary wiring and electrical changes.

If you need to charge your vehicle away from home, you can still charge it with solar energy by using a solar-powered public EV charging station. These stations are typically located in public places like gas stations and parking lots, providing convenient access for drivers who do not have access to a home solar EV charging station.

The cost to charge your electric car with grid energy, will vary depending on your energy tariff and car battery size. Using solar panels to charge an electric car can reduce carbon emissions and save the average household over £400 a year. Solar panels offer homeowners a way of generating clean, renewable energy to power their homes. So can they also charge our electric vehicles? In short, yes!
The Energy Saving Trust estimates that an average 4kW solar array in the UK will save you over £400 a year. Solar PV systems can generate enough electricity to fully charge an electric car. A typical domestic solar PV system can generate around four kilowatts of power, which is enough to charge an electric car.
The average domestic solar PV system can generate one to four kilowatts of power (kWp). This is enough to fully charge an electric car with a battery capacity of 40 kWh in just over eight hours. Of course, the amount of solar energy available to charge an electric car will vary depending on the time of year and the weather conditions.
Solar panel EV charging is a straightforward process that harnesses the sun's energy to power electric vehicles. Solar panels collect sunlight and turn it into electricity. However, this electricity isn't ready for your car yet. It needs to be changed into the right type of power. This is where an EV charger becomes crucial.
